Aims & Scope
Founded in 2004, Cultura: International Journal of Philosophy of Culture and Axiology is a peer-reviewed publication devoted to philosophy of culture and the study of values.
It promote the exploration of different values and cultural phenomena in regional and international contexts.
It welcomes manuscripts that make a novel and important contribution to our understanding of the values and cultural phenomena in the contemporary world.
Cultura is primarily published in English, and occasionally also publishes articles in German, French, and Italian.
